A project has an estimated duration of 10 months with a total budget of US$220,000. At the end of the fifth month, it is estimated that at completion, the project will incur US$250,000.
If the actual cost (AC) calculated is US$150,000, what is the earned value (EV) of the project?

  • A. US$-30,000
  • B. US$120,000
  • C. US$370,000
  • D. US$400,000

EAC = US$250,000. BAC = US$220,000 AC = US$150,000 EAC = AC + BAC - EV EV = AC + BAC - EAC EV = US$150,000 + US$220,000 - US$250,000 EV = US$120,000
